Interactive, Fast Paced, Radio Program Connecting Youth
in Africa and the United States
On this fresh, fast-paced show, co-hosts located in the U.S. and in Africa talk to teens and young adults about trends, lifestyles, health, entertainment, and other issues touching listeners’ lives [30 minutes]
“This show is fun and interactive, says co-host Jackson Mvunganyi.” “We give our listeners a chance to say what they think about a range of topics.” “I’m thrilled to be part of such a dynamic, cutting-edge show.”
A native of Rwanda, Jackson has a bachelors degree in multimedia development from the American University in Washington D.C., and a masters degree in Information Management at the University of Maryland. Jackson has had a multi-faceted broadcasting career so far, working in both radio and television, in Africa and the United States. Jackson also volunteers his time with African communities in the Diaspora on issues affecting the continent.

Nadia Samie, already an on-air personality in and around Cape Town, also serves as co-host of Up Front. Nadia currently works at Bush Radio in Cape Town, a VOA affiliate station, in addition to her duties on Up Front.
She reports on a range of issues within the local community, including those of interest to the youth. “Young adults want to have a say, and we are giving them the chance to do that on Up Front,” she notes. “I just love this medium… there’s something magical about radio.”
